    Apple Unveils Budget-Friendly iPhone 16e With Apple Intelligence

    Apple has officially unveiled the iPhone 16e, a more affordable version of the iPhone 16, marking the company’s renewed push into the budget smartphone market. This new model, priced at $599, is set to launch on February 28, 2025. It will be the cheapest iPhone supporting Apple Intelligence.

    A key highlight of the iPhone 16e is Apple’s in-house designed cellular modem, making it the first iPhone to feature an Apple-built modem.

    iPhone 16e vs iPhone SE: A Shift in Apple’s Budget Strategy

    The introduction of the iPhone 16e signifies a shift away from the iPhone SE, Apple’s previous budget iPhone line that debuted in 2016 and last saw an update in 2022.

    According to Consumer Intelligence Research Partners, the iPhone SE accounted for just 5% of U.S. iPhone sales as of December 2024, prompting Apple to rethink its budget strategy.

    Unlike the SE, the iPhone 16e offers a more modern design, bringing it closer to Apple’s current lineup with a 6.1-inch display, Face ID, and a 48MP camera.

    How to set Set your play area:

    Hover over the clock on the left side of the universal menu. When Quick Settings appears, select it to open the Quick Settings panel. Select Boundary.

    When you’re setting up your boundary, you can pick from these modes:

    1. Stationary: This is for when you’re using your headset while sitting or standing still. It sets up a default boundary area of 3 feet by 3 feet (1 meter by 1 meter) centered on where you are.
    2. Roomscale: This mode is for when you want to move around in your play area. With Roomscale, you can use your Touch controller to draw the boundaries in your physical space. It’s best to have a safe and clear area that’s at least 6.5 feet by 6.5 feet (2 meters by 2 meters).

    How do VR Headsets (Virtual Reality Headset) work?

    VR Headsets

    Currently, the use of VR headsets is limitless; every day, new ways of utilizing virtual reality technologies emerge. VR headsets immerse users in a simulated three-dimensional setting, by completely shutting off the real world. Virtual reality glasses usually feature a display screen, audio, sensors, and controllers, that enable users to enjoy life-like content. A VR headset can be used to play video games, meditate, stream sports, attend concerts, do real estate tours, have meetings, etc.

    There are three types of VR headsets; mobile, connected, and standalone VR headsets. Mobile VR headsets operate with smartphones (Android and iPhones to provide immersive virtual reality experiences. Connected or tethered VR headsets as the name implies utilize PCs or consoles to deliver VR content. While the standalone VR headsets come fully equipped and do not use external devices to function.

    To use a virtual reality headset, set up the device and place it on your head. Once the external surroundings are blocked or you can no longer see the world around you. When your field of view (FOV) adjusts to the environment projected on the display screen, use the controllers to interact with the simulated content.

  • Apple Watch Blood Oxygen Monitoring  Feature Removed Following Patent Dispute

    Apple Watch Blood Oxygen Monitoring Feature Removed Following Patent Dispute

    Due to a patent dispute with Masimo, Apple plans to omit the Apple watch blood oxygen monitoring feature from its latest smartwatch models, the Series 9 and Ultra 2. This is in response to a potential ban on the devices in the United States, pending the outcome of an appeal.

    The disclosure came on Monday from Masimo Corp., a company entangled in a patent dispute with Apple concerning the technology behind Apple watch blood oxygen measurement. Masimo revealed that the U.S. Customs and Border Protection approved this plan on January 12, asserting that Apple’s redesign falls outside the scope of the import ban imposed by the U.S. International Trade Commission. This decision suggests that Apple’s adjustment will enable it to maintain the availability of its watches in the market.

    The dispute originated from an ITC ruling in October, declaring that Apple’s devices violated Masimo’s patents related to Apple Watch blood oxygen measurement. Consequently, Apple halted the sales of its smartwatches just before Christmas, but an interim stay allowed the company to resume sales late last month.

    To address the issue, Apple developed a software workaround to resolve the dispute and presented the solution to the customs agency last week. The watches, according to Apple, unequivocally do not contain the disputed technology known as pulse oximetry, as confirmed by Masimo.

    This is contingent on the outcome of Apple’s appeal to a federal court for a longer stay. The company anticipates a ruling from the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Federal Circuit as early as Tuesday, with the possibility of the appeal period lasting a year or more.

    During this interim period, the Apple Watch blood oxygen feature remains available on newly sold Apple Watch units. However, if the appeal fails, the removal of this feature would be a consequential move to avert the reimposition of the ban, which could have taken effect as soon as this month.

    Masimo commended Apple’s claim that the redesigned watch does not contain pulse oximetry, emphasizing the importance of large companies respecting intellectual property rights. Removing the technology from the Apple Watch could impact customer demand, but it seems Apple is prepared for this scenario, having shipped modified Series 9 and Ultra 2 watches to U.S. retail locations, pending corporate approval.

    Simultaneously, a federal appeals court is expected to address Apple’s motion for a continued stay on the ban. The ITC has urged the court to reject arguments opposing the enforcement of the ban, characterizing them as “weak and unconvincing.”

  • Apple Watch Series 9 Sales Paused Amidst Patent Dispute

    Apple Watch Series 9 Sales Paused Amidst Patent Dispute

    Apple has officially announced the suspension of sales for the Apple Watch Series 9 due to an ongoing patent disagreement with Masimo, a California-based med-tech company. The International Trade Commission (ITC) ruled in October regarding the dispute, specifically related to the blood sensor monitor featured in Apple’s flagship smartwatch.

    The sales halt will occur online on December 21 at 3 P.M., with retail locations discontinuing sales on December 24, just before the holiday season. This date also marks the final day for the pickup and delivery of online orders.

    In response to the situation, Apple released a statement explaining that a Presidential Review Period is underway regarding the ITC’s order on a technical intellectual property dispute concerning the Blood Oxygen feature in Apple Watch devices. Although the review period extends until December 25, Apple is proactively taking measures to comply with a potential ruling. This includes temporarily halting sales of the Apple Watch Series 9 and Apple Watch Ultra 2 on Apple.com starting December 21, and in Apple retail locations after December 24.

    Despite disagreeing strongly with the ITC’s order, Apple is actively exploring legal and technical options to ensure the availability of the Apple Watch to its customers. If the ruling is upheld, Apple commits to taking all necessary steps to promptly return the Apple Watch Series 9 and Apple Watch Ultra 2 to U.S. customers.

    Additionally, Apple plans to appeal the ruling, asserting that it believes the ITC’s decision is erroneous. The company initiated legal action against Masimo in October of the previous year, alleging patent infringement. Apple accused Masimo of attempting to use the ITC to hinder the availability of a potentially life-saving product to millions of U.S. consumers while promoting its watch that allegedly imitates Apple’s.

    The core of the dispute revolves around pulse oximetry, a technology utilizing an optical sensor to detect blood flow. Masimo’s original complaint, dating back to June 2021, primarily focused on technology introduced with the Apple Watch Series 6. Masimo recently obtained FDA clearance for its wrist-worn product for both prescription and over-the-counter use.

  • Amazon Echo Show 8: Users will be Charged for Digital Photo Frame

    Amazon Echo Show 8: Users will be Charged for Digital Photo Frame

    Over the years, Amazon has introduced a range of smart speakers and Alexa-enabled devices. Among the top favorite Alexa devices is the Amazon Echo Show 8. For those unfamiliar with Alexa products, the Echo Show series includes smart displays integrated with Alexa’s capabilities. Despite being Amazon’s second smallest smart display, the Echo Show 8 boasts an impressive eight-inch touchscreen, and unlike the Echo Show 10 and 15, it is compact and very portable.

    What is the Amazon Echo Show 8 used for?

    The Echo Show 8 has quite a lot of uses; from live streaming videos to playing music, checking weather updates, connecting to home security cameras and other smart home devices, and even making video calls. The third generation of the Echo Show 8 which is yet to hit the market (possibly late October 2023) will be sold for $150. A slight increase from its predecessor—the Amazon Echo Show 8(2021 version), which was initially sold for $129.99.

    Amazon Echo Show 8 Subscription

    Amazon is introducing a new feature for its Echo Show 8. However, this added functionality comes at an extra cost. The Echo Show 8 Photos Edition, unveiled at the recent fall hardware event, carries a $10 premium over the standard model.

    This premium allows you to set your photos as the “primary home screen content.” Priced at $159.99, the Show 8 Photos Edition boasts all the same features as the third-gen Echo Show 8. The additional $10 grants you a complimentary six-month subscription to Amazon’s latest service, PhotosPlus, enabling the enhanced photo mode. PhotosPlus introduces Photo Mode, which prioritizes personal memories and images shared by your loved ones on the Echo Show 8 Photos Edition’s home screen.

    The New Echo Show 8 Features (third generation)

    It also boasts a 30-second slideshow rotation for a more impactful display around your home, along with 25 GB of storage for photos and videos from Amazon Photos. Prime members receive unlimited photo storage and an additional 5 GB for videos. Despite sharing the same hardware, the standard Show 8 does not support the new Photo Mode, which is exclusive to the Echo Show 8 Photos Edition.

    A persistent critique of Echo Show devices has been the absence of a dedicated photo frame feature, especially in comparison to Google’s Nest Hub devices, which excel in this regard. Currently, activating photo frame mode on Echo Show displays lasts only three hours before reverting to a rotating display often featuring ads and promotions, unless you navigate menus to disable it. The third-gen Echo Show 8 is available in two variants: standard and Photos Edition.

    Subscription

    Photo Mode revolutionizes the display on existing Show screens, ensuring photos take center stage indefinitely, Ramirez assures. The user interface foregrounds your photos, while information like weather and time recedes into the background.

    Subscribing to a digital photo frame service isn’t a novel concept; certain frames require payment for uploads or offer supplementary features at a cost. For instance, the Skylight Calendar offers a digital calendar with an optional $39 annual fee for a photo frame feature. They also provide a Skylight Frame with no upload fee but offer additional features like cloud backup and albums for $39 per year.

    Beyond the initial six months, maintaining Photo Mode requires a monthly fee of $1.99. Although cancellation is an option at any time, discontinuing the subscription reverts your Echo Show 8 Photos Edition to its standard configuration.

    Likewise, the popular Aura Frame comes without a fee and is $10 cheaper than Amazon’s new photo-centric Show. However, it lacks other smart display features such as Alexa voice assistance, smart home controls, and streaming capabilities.

    Apple’s latest product release at the Apple Event 2023 officially launched the all-new iPhone 15, and the iPhone 15 Plus which comes with expansive displays that mirror the dimensions of the iPhone 14 series. The iPhone 15 Pro and iPhone 15 Pro Max models, valued at $999 and $1,199, respectively, introduce an innovative action button instead of the conventional Apple mute switch.

    This multifaceted button is a significant departure and replacement and can be used for several functions. Unlike its physical counterpart, this button relies on haptic feedback, enabling a range of device functions. By default, the action button toggles between ring and silent modes, emulating the function of the mute switch. Despite the absence of a tactile toggle, distinct haptic feedback cues users into the active setting. This innovation empowers users to customize the action button, granting quick access to various functions.

    iPhone 15 and iPhone 15 Plus Credit: Apple
    iPhone 15 and iPhone 15 Plus Credit: Apple

    Aside from silencing or unmuting, the button can also activate iOS 17 shortcuts, launch the flashlight, open the camera, record voice memos, provide translations, and activate accessibility features like Magnifier. Apple also assures that the Dynamic Island will offer visual cues, complementing the haptic feedback for seamless operation. The lingering question is whether the action button can be configured for multiple actions through different tap combinations, such as a single tap for the flashlight and a double tap for the camera.

    Apple also emphasizes sustainability with the revelation that the batteries of the iPhone 15 and iPhone 15 Plus, are constructed entirely from recycled cobalt. While Apple has not officially disclosed the highly anticipated iPhone 15 release date, there are speculations that availability will be starting September 15, followed by the official retail launch on September 22.

    Design, USB-C, and Other Features

    iPhone 15 and iPhone 15 Plus Credit: Apple
    iPhone 15 and iPhone 15 Plus Credit: Apple

    The iPhone 15 Pro maintains last year’s screen sizes; a 6.1-inch display for the standard model and a 6.7-inch display for the Pro Max. However, Apple has achieved a sleeker look by slimming down the borders, resulting in a slightly smaller form compared to the iPhone 14 counterparts. The obvious upgrade is Apple’s transition from stainless steel to Grade 5 titanium. This switch improves strength and durability while reducing weightiness. Grade 5 titanium has superior resistance to corrosion and greater tensile strength compared to pure titanium. Apple equally opted for titanium over stainless steel for the sidebars in these shiny new premium models.

    All models now sport an impressive 48-megapixel primary camera. The flagship Pro Max is made with a remarkable 5X optical zoom and 3X telephoto capability. With the Pro series, users gain the ability to capture “spatial” or three-dimensional videos which is very much ideal for compatibility with Apple’s forthcoming Vision Pro headset. In terms of improving safety features, the latest iPhones with Emergency SOS Satellite connectivity can now summon roadside assistance, a service initially launched in partnership with the American Automobile Association in the United States.

    In compliance with European legislation, Apple shifted gears by adopting the USB-C charging standard, replacing the longstanding Lightning port for the new iPhones and AirPods Pro. Also, this alteration is claimed to simplify the process for professionals who want to transfer video content directly from their iPhones to their hard drives. Under the hood, the 15 and 15 Plus, priced from $799 and $899, are driven by the A16 Bionic chip, while the Pro iterations are built with the powerhouse A17 Pro Chip.
